Circuit Breaker Replacement in Orem, UT
Circuit breaker replacement services involve removing and installing new circuit breakers to ensure the electrical system functions safely and reliably. This service covers a range of projects, including replacing outdated or damaged breakers, upgrading panels to handle increased electrical demands, and restoring proper circuit protection after issues such as frequent tripping or electrical faults. Homeowners often seek this service to prevent electrical hazards, improve energy efficiency, or accommodate the addition of new appliances and devices within their property.
Before requesting circuit breaker replacement, property owners typically want to understand the signs indicating a need for service, such as frequent breaker trips, a breaker that won't reset, or visible damage to the breaker or electrical panel. It’s also important to know the compatibility of new breakers with existing panels and the potential need for panel upgrades in older homes. Ensuring proper installation and understanding the scope of work can help maintain electrical safety and prevent future electrical issues.

Common Circuit Breaker Replacement Jobs
Circuit breaker replacement involves upgrading or swapping out outdated or damaged circuit breakers to ensure electrical safety.
Main breaker replacement helps restore proper power distribution and prevents overloads in the electrical system.
Arc fault circuit interrupter (AFCI) replacement enhances protection against electrical fires by replacing outdated AFCI devices.
Ground fault circuit interrupter (GFCI) replacement provides improved protection in areas prone to moisture, such as kitchens and bathrooms.
Panel upgrade and breaker replacement improve electrical capacity and safety for growing power needs in the property.
Emergency breaker replacement addresses sudden breaker trips or failures to restore reliable electrical service.
Circuit Breaker Replacement Questions
What are signs that a circuit breaker needs replacement? Signs include frequent tripping, visible damage, or a breaker that won't reset after trips.
Why is replacing a circuit breaker important? Replacement ensures continued electrical safety and prevents potential fire hazards or electrical failures.
Can a homeowner replace a circuit breaker themselves? It is recommended to have a qualified professional handle replacement to ensure safety and proper installation.
What types of circuit breakers are commonly replaced? Standard single-pole and double-pole breakers are often replaced due to wear or damage over time.
